Get started14 Arlingham Avenue is a four-bedroom mid-terrace house in Bromsgrove (B61 8AP). It has a recorded floor area of 122 m² (around 1313 sq ft), construction records dating it to 2007-2011 and council tax band D. The latest certificate (May 2024) returns a B (score 84), comfortably above the UK average. The rating has held steady at B across 2 certificates since November 2011. Between certificates, wall efficiency dropped from Very Good to Good and roof efficiency dropped from Very Good to Good. The recommended improvements would push it to A (score 92).
Sale prices here have outpaced Bromsgrove HPI: 3.8% per year against 0% for the wider region. Today's modelled estimate of £190,000 is 47.3% above the 2021 sale price.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£98/sq ft) was about 35.6% above the typical sold price in the postcode. Last sale on file: £129,000 in November 2021. That sale was during the post-pandemic price surge, when transactions cleared materially above pre-2020 trend.
14 Arlingham Avenue saw 3 transfers in just over a decade — high turnover for the postcode.
